Doctoral School
Gdańsk University of Technology (Gdańsk Tech) offers education in the Doctoral School which is free of charge, provides a scholarship, and a creative and interdisciplinary approach to research. Our school was founded in 2019 and started functioning as of the academic year 2019/2020. However, the doctoral studies at our university are more than 30 years old.
The Ph.D. training is conducted in 13 disciplines fully in English. Two of these are also offered within our cooperation with the two institutes of the Polish Academy of Sciences, both based in Gdańsk - the Szewalski Institute of Fluid-Flow Machinery (discipline: mechanical engineering) and the Institute of Hydro-Engineering (discipline: civil engineering and transport). All of these programs are interdisciplinary.

Economics
PhD program in social sciences is run at the Faculty of Management and Economics (Gdansk Tech) and offers 4-year-long PhD training in two alternative disciplines: (1) Economics and Finance and (2) Management and Quality Studies. The program is designed for students interested in advanced training and conducting theoretical or empirical/applied research related to economics, management, business studies, or finance.
Given the research profile of the faculty, the main areas of specialisation refer to: (i) broadly understood International Economics, (ii) Corporate Finance and Financial markets, (iii) various aspects of Organisational Behaviour, Management and Quality Research. Potential research topics offered in academic year 2022/2023 include (but are not limited to): international trade, global value chains, digital and energy transition, labour economics, financial markets, forecasting, bankruptcy and risk, socio-economic development, technological progress, sport economy, public management, smart cities, knowledge management, innovation management, sustainability, organizational behaviour, information security management, cybersecurity, company culture and organisational learning.
The program offers an extensive training on theoretical underpinnings of modern economic/management studies and on advanced empirical research methods using macro- and micro-economic data.
The graduates of this PhD programme will be prepared to continue their career in academia (mainly in the departments of macro-/micro-economics, international economics, economic analysis or finance, management), in research institutions or think-tanks, business sector (multinational companies), financial sector (banks, insurance companies), public administration or in international economic and financial institutions.
